Hi,
I need such a code which should copy this range A2:D2 and then paste as simple numbers into this range A1:D1.
When i run this code again then it should copy this range A3:D3 and then paste as simple numbers into this range A1:D1.
When i run this code again then it should copy this range A4:D4 and then paste as simple numbers into this range A1:D1.
and so on

Let's say if range A5:D5 has blank cells, and if i run code. Then instead of copying and pasting this range, it should show a message saying "Task Completed".

Hi, so I spent a little more time thinking about it.. and this code might get you what you want ?
Its not particularly pretty, and it assumes that each time you run the macro, you still have the previous rows data in cells A1-D1.
If you delete that row, then it will assume you are starting again from Row 1.

Hope it helps.
VBA Code:
Sub Test()

Dim Rng1, Rng2 As Range
Dim Rn1, Rn2 As Variant

Set Rng1 = Range("A1:D1")
Rn1 = Range("A1:D1").Value


For x = 2 To 5
    Result = True
    If Application.WorksheetFunction.CountA(Range(Cells(x, 1), Cells(x, 4))) > 0 Then
        If Application.WorksheetFunction.CountA(Rng1) = 0 Then
            Set Rng1 = Range(Cells(x, 1), Cells(x, 4)) 'default row 2 if Row 1 is empty
            Exit For
        Else
            Rn2 = Range(Cells(x, 1), Cells(x, 4)).Value
            For y = 1 To 4
                If Rn1(1, y) <> Rn2(1, y) Then Result = False
            Next y
            If Result = True And x < 4 Then
                rownum = x + 1
                Set Rng1 = ActiveSheet.Range(ActiveSheet.Cells(rownum, 1), ActiveSheet.Cells(rownum, 4))
                Exit For
            End If
            
        End If

    End If

Next x

Sheets("Sheet1").Range("A1:D1") = Rng1.Value
If x = 6 Then MsgBox ("Task Completed")

End Sub
